  Humacyte, Inc.HUMA stock is trending on Tuesday. In July, the company has so far added Dr. John P. Bamforth and Dr. Keith Anthony to its Board of Directors, entered a license agreement with Pluristyx and received Regenerative Medicine Advanced Therapy (RMAT) designation by the FDA for its Acellular Tissue Engineered Vessel.

  The Details:Humacyte acquired a license for Pluristyxs PluriBank induced Pluripotent Stem Cell (iPSC) line to use as starting materials in the production of insulin-producing cells for their BioVascular Pancreas (BVP) product candidate.

  The BVP aims to treat type 1 diabetes by facilitating the delivery and survival of insulin-producing islets within the body.

  “The combination of Humacyte‘s Acellular Tissue Engineered Vessel (ATEV) with insulin-producing cells derived from Pluristyx’s best-in-class iPSC lines brings us one step closer to curing insulin dependent diabetes,” said Benjamin Fryer, Pluristyxs CEO.

  “We are excited to assist therapeutic developers in using clinical-grade PluriBank iPSC starting materials.”

  At the start of the month, the company received RMAT designation for the application of Humacytes ATEV in patients with Advanced Peripheral Artery Disease (PAD). This treatment is particularly beneficial for PAD patients who may not have suitable veins for traditional lower leg bypass procedures.

  The ATEV is an implantable conduit designed for blood vessel replacement and repair. It has demonstrated low infection rates in clinical trials and is readily available off-the-shelf for immediate surgical use.
